Inside the Villa: Designed for Real Life
The way a villa is designed has a huge impact on how it feels to live in every day. It's not just about the size of the rooms or the materials used, but how each space connects with the next. Thoughtful layouts create a natural flow between indoor and outdoor areas, allowing gardens, courtyards, and pool spaces to feel like an extension of the home. Large openings bring in natural light, while cross ventilation helps fresh air move comfortably through the villa. These details may seem subtle on paper, but they shape the overall living experience, making the home feel more open, relaxed, and connected to its surroundings. Living areas open straight onto the pool deck. Bedrooms get their own pocket of privacy without feeling cut off from the rest of the house. Even the materials: laterite stone, sloped tiled roofs borrow from older Goan homes instead of ignoring them.
It's the kind of design that feels effortless. You just notice, after a few days, that nothing about the house gets in your way.
